Another reason in order to avoid using your foam roller straight on your back may be the proximity of the all-crucial kidneys and liver. Whilst muscles might give a bit of padding, these organs don’t get loads of protection from your bones the best way your coronary heart and lungs, which Reside inside your rib cage, do. Functioning indirectly could make it easier to respect your organs' vulnerability to injuries.

 This is actually the crux of the problem.  The Nationwide Institute of Health and fitness states that many lower back pain is mechanical in mother nature, this means There's a disruption in just how the components with the back (the spine, muscle, discs, and nerves) work with each other.  Putting a foam roller less than your lower back forces your backbone into an unnatural, arched placement, which can aggravate People fundamental mechanical troubles far more!
